'President's address reflects government commitment to rural welfare'


New Delhi, Feb 23 (IANS): Union Environment Minister Prakash Javadekar on Tuesday said that the President's address to parliament on Tuesday reflected richly the Modi government's work for development of the rural poor and the under-privileged.

“President’s address reflects Modi government’s commitment to the welfare of villages, poor, farmers and youth. It gives confidence to the nation that the government which started with 'Sabka Saath Sabka Vikas', is on right track,” Javadekar said in his tweets.

He requested all political parties to let parliament transact its business smoothly during the Budget session. 

“To repay the debt of freedom fighters, all parliamentarians are duty bound to ensure smooth running of parliament. Congress is desperate, depressed and is not reconciled that it is not in power," Javadekar said. 

"Last 2 Paras of president's address are important. He asserted that running of Parliament is everybody’s responsibility,” Javadekar said in another tweet.
